#111600 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#111600 is composed of 6.7% red, 8.6%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 22.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 100% yellow and 91.4% black. It has a hue angle of 73.6 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 4.3%. #111600 color hex could be obtained by blending #222c00 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#000000.

● #111600 color description : Very dark (mostly black) yellow [Olive tone].
#111600 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#111600 has RGB values of R:17, G:22, B:0 and CMYK values of C:0.23, M:0, Y:1, K:0.91. Its decimal value is 1119744.
